There is an LRT station right at the stadium, we took it from the game back to our hotel in downtown San Jose. It's really easy it just gets really busy after the game is all. The trains are pretty packed leaving, but they have crowd control that puts everyone in one area for the trains and gets you on - eventually.

It's a pretty good experience though, the stadium is really nice and the weather is also great compared to here. We took the train both ways and had zero issues, I think a lot of people do the same thing. You could probably take an Uber to get there, but it would be a gong show trying to get one to leave. Best bet is the LRT.

There's lots of hotels in the downtown San Jose area with bars, pubs and places to eat all over - and the LRT runs right through it. We were at the Fairmont in downtown San Jose and the train station was right beside us.

I like San Francisco better than San Jose, but the stadium is waaaay easier to get to from San Jose. It's not even close to San Fran really.
